Re: Making powerd=YES default



On 01.08.2011 18:57, Alan Barrett wrote:
> On Mon, 01 Aug 2011, Jean-Yves Migeon wrote:
>> Quite frankly, I am more and more convinced that an additional
>> /etc/defaults/rc.md.conf is the right fix then. This one could be
>> included from /etc/defaults/rc.conf, apply some MD-specific changes,
>> and still let the user override the value in /etc/rc.conf if he wants to.
> 
> I suggest making the contents of /etc/defaults/rc.conf be
> machine-dependent.  A script run at build time could create it from MI
> and MD fragments.  Put powerd=NO in some of the fragments, and
> powerd=YES in other fragments.

I am leaning towards this, although I am still unsure which one would be
best, between MI + MD => generate defaults/rc.conf, or have a MI
defaults/rc.conf which calls MD hooks if they are present.

There's no "one and only one" solution, let's see which one is less
invasive.
